WebIn astronomy, the barycenter (or barycentre; from Ancient Greek βαρύς (barús) 'heavy', and κέντρον (kéntron) 'center') [1] is the center of mass of two or more bodies that orbit one another and is the point about which the bodies orbit. A barycenter is a dynamical point, not a physical object. It is an important concept in fields ... WebOct 13, 2024 · The centre of mass is the point around which the mass is evenly balanced. The center of gravity is the point around which the gravitational force on each particle of the object is balanced. If this force of gravity is greater on one side (force gradient) then the center of gravity will be shifted in that direction—just as the centre of mass ...
